What Is Car Key Programming?

Modern car keys aren't just simple pieces of metal. They are equipped with an embedded computer chip that communicates with your car.

This is vital to ensure your vehicle's security and prevent unauthorized use. You must program the keys to work with your vehicle. This is a job that should be left to experts.

Security

Contrary to the older keys for cars made of metal modern cars make use of transponder chips to unlock and start the engine. This technology makes it impossible to make copies of a programmed key and allows only authorized cars to start their vehicles. It is an effective way to deter theft in the DC Metro area.

Programming a car key involves connecting it to the car's computer and transmitting information to the key fob. Most modern automobiles require a specific key programming tool to connect the transponder chip to the car's immobilizer system. This procedure is usually performed by a locksmith, though certain parts stores carry the tools necessary for this task. These tools, like the Autel MaxiIM IM608PRO and IM508, let users retrieve immobilizer data and program replacement keys.

It is not recommended to reprogram your car keys. The process can be complex and time-consuming, and could result in damage to the immobilizer. In addition, it's important to consult the manual of your vehicle for specific instructions on reprogramming the key. In general, only a licensed auto locksmith should perform this task.

Easy of Use

Most modern cars require a specific key programming procedure. In contrast to older mechanical keys, most modern cars contain transponder chips which must be programmed to recognize distinct signals generated by the car. Without this, the car will not start or run, which prevents anyone from connecting it to the internet and driving away. This is why most auto locksmiths are experts in this service.

In certain instances keys can be reprogrammed with no help of any tools, though some vehicles require a tool referred to as key programmer. These units may be standalone units or integrated into sophisticated scan tools. They typically bidirectionally interface with the on-board diagnostics II (OBD-II) connector. Most car manufacturers offer programming devices for their vehicles, however generic ones are also available.

The process of programming a new key to match the car's setting is known as "car key programming." This is an intricate procedure that requires special equipment and education. But, it's a worthwhile investment because a well-programmed car key can make it harder for thieves to take your car.
